Compensate for barrel distortion
Barrel distortion is a phenomenon where straight lines appear increasingly bent closer to the edges of the frame. A wide field of view
often creates barrel distortion in an image. Barrel distortion correction compensates for this distortion.
Note
Barrel distortion correction affects the image resolution and field of view.
1. Go to Video > Installation > Image correction.
2. Turn on Barrel distortion correction (BDC).
